Supporting the Implementation of Inquiry-based Elementary Science Programs: Setting the Stage for Local Reform.
Lumpe, Andrew T.; Czerniak, Charlene M.; Haney, Jodi J.
Electronic Journal of Science Education, v3 n4 Jun 1999
Describes the context and support structures involved in the implementation of a National Science Foundation (NSF)-funded professional development program designed to train elementary teachers to use exemplary science curriculum materials. Identifies components for the successful implementation of systemic reform efforts including purposeful interactions among all important stakeholders in the project, peer mentoring by teacher leaders, and purposeful experiences with the science curriculum materials.
